Wisnu Nurcahyo is a scholar working on Small Animals, Animal Science and Zoology and Parasitology. According to data from OpenAlex, Wisnu Nurcahyo has authored 85 papers receiving a total of 398 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Small Animals, 30 papers in Animal Science and Zoology and 25 papers in Parasitology. Recurrent topics in Wisnu Nurcahyo’s work include Helminth infection and control (32 papers), Parasite Biology and Host Interactions (18 papers) and Coccidia and coccidiosis research (16 papers). Wisnu Nurcahyo is often cited by papers focused on Helminth infection and control (32 papers), Parasite Biology and Host Interactions (18 papers) and Coccidia and coccidiosis research (16 papers). Wisnu Nurcahyo collaborates with scholars based in Indonesia, Czechia and United Kingdom. Wisnu Nurcahyo's co-authors include Joko Prastowo, Helen C. Morrogh‐Bernard, Božena Koubková, April Hari Wardhana, Dana Květoňová, Martin Kváč, Bohumil Sak, V. Baruš, Karel Doležal and Mark E. Harrison and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Scientific Reports and Parasitology.
